البرمجة

أهمية إغلاق تيار الملف في جافا

أهمية إغلاق تيار الملف في لغة البرمجة جافا

مع التقدم الهائل في وحدات المعالجة المركزية التي أصبحت قادرة على معالجة كميات ضخمة من المعلومات في جزء صغير من الثانية، يظل إغلاق تيار الملف في لغة البرمجة جافا أمرًا ذا أهمية خاصة. يعود هذا التأكيد على أهمية إغلاق تيار الملف إلى عدة جوانب تتعلق بأداء البرنامج واستدامته.

أولًا وقبل كل شيء، يأتي إغلاق تيار الملف كضمان للتنظيف الفعّال. عندما يتم فتح تيار لقراءة أو كتابة الملف، يتم تخصيص موارد النظام لهذا التيار. وفي حالة عدم إغلاق التيار بشكل صحيح، قد يتسبب ذلك في تسرب غير مرغوب فيه لهذه الموارد، مما يؤدي إلى استهلاك غير فعّال للذاكرة ويمكن أن يؤثر على أداء البرنامج بشكل كبير.

ثانيًا، يرتبط إغلاق تيار الملف بتأكيد البيانات والتحديثات. عندما يتم إجراء تعديلات على الملف، يجب أن تتم عملية إغلاق التيار بشكل صحيح لضمان حفظ جميع التحديثات. إذا تم ترك التيار مفتوحًا، فإن أي تعديلات قد لا تُحفظ بشكل صحيح، مما قد يؤدي إلى فقدان البيانات أو التلاعب بها.

ثالثًا، تأتي أهمية إغلاق تيار الملف من الناحية الأمانية. عند فتح تيار الملف، يتم فتح قناة اتصال بين البرنامج والملف نفسه. وبترك هذه القناة مفتوحة دون الإغلاق السليم، يمكن أن يكون هناك خطر من وصول غير مصرح به إلى الملف، مما يعرض البيانات للتهديدات الأمنية.

إلى جانب ذلك، يمكن تلخيص الأمور بأن إغلاق تيار الملف في لغة البرمجة جافا يُعَدُّ عملية ضرورية للمحافظة على فاعلية البرنامج واستقراره. إن لم يُغلق التيار بشكل صحيح، فقد يكون هناك تأثير كبير على أداء البرنامج وامكانية حدوث مشاكل غير متوقعة. لذا، يُشدد دائمًا على أهمية هذه الخطوة في عمليات البرمجة للحفاظ على كفاءة النظام وأمانه.

المزيد من المعلومات

بالطبع، دعونا نقوم بتوسيع نطاق النقاش لفهم المزيد حول أهمية إغلاق تيار الملف في لغة البرمجة جافا.

رابعًا، يأتي دور إغلاق تيار الملف في التعامل مع الملفات الكبيرة وتحسين أداء البرنامج. عند قراءة أو كتابة ملف كبير، يمكن أن يكون تأثير ترك التيار مفتوحًا كبيرًا على استهلاك الذاكرة. إغلاق التيار بشكل صحيح يعني تحرير الموارد التي كانت قد تم تخصيصها له، مما يساهم في تحسين أداء البرنامج وتفادي حدوث مشاكل فيما بعد.

خامسًا، يجدر بالذكر أن إغلاق تيار الملف يساهم في جعل البرمجة أكثر نظافة وصيانة. عندما يتم إغلاق تيار الملف بشكل صحيح، يكون الكود أكثر قوة ويسهل فهمه للمطورين الآخرين الذين قد يتابعون العمل على البرنامج في المستقبل. هذا يعزز فهم الشيفرة البرمجية ويسهل عمليات الصيانة وتطوير البرنامج بشكل عام.

سادسًا، يُعَدُّ إغلاق تيار الملف جزءًا أساسيًا من مبدأ استخدام الموارد بشكل فعال. في بيئات البرمجة الحديثة حيث يتم التعامل مع الكثير من البيانات والملفات، يصبح تحرير الموارد بمجرد الانتهاء من استخدامها أمرًا أساسيًا لتجنب تجميع الموارد والتأثير السلبي على أداء النظام.

إجمالًا، يمكن القول إن إغلاق تيار الملف في لغة البرمجة جافا ليس مجرد عملية فنية صغيرة، بل هو جزء أساسي من ممارسات البرمجة الجيدة. يسهم في تحسين أداء البرنامج، وضمان سلامة البيانات، وتسهيل صيانة الشيفرة البرمجية، واستخدام الموارد بشكل فعّال.

زر الذهاب إلى الأعلى